Nigerian military and vigilantes reclaim Nigerian towns from Boko Haram.

Nigerian troops in conjunction with vigilantes have reclaimed two towns seized by Boko Haram last week. Gombi and Hong towns were recaptured from the Islamic militants on Tuesday after soldiers and the vigilantes, backed by fighter jets stormed the towns on Monday and engaged the militants in a fierce gunfight.

Residents say that the gun battle claimed the lives of several militants, while 10 soldiers were killed. The two towns had been under Islamist control since last Thursday after pushing out troops with hundreds of residents fleeing for safety.

The military have confirmed the capture of many militants in the operation while others died in the assault. They have also recovered the militants' weapons and equipment.
